In Short : NTPC Green Energy Limited has declared commercial operation of 158.4 MW from its 250 MW solar photovoltaic project in Andhra Pradesh. The milestone enhances the company’s installed renewable capacity beyond 9 GW, reinforcing its leadership in India’s clean energy transition and supporting national decarbonisation and energy security goals. In Short : Vayona Energy has secured a major contract to supply 64.8 MW of wind turbines to Oyster Renewable Energy, reinforcing its position in India’s growing wind energy market. The agreement supports Oyster’s capacity expansion plans and reflects increasing momentum in clean energy investments. In Short : Rajasthan has invested ₹35 crore in artificial intelligence and digital tools to improve power procurement efficiency across its electricity sector. The initiative focuses on data-driven decision-making, demand forecasting, and system optimisation to reduce costs, enhance transparency, and strengthen operational performance while supporting long-term energy security and grid reliability. In Short : Jupiter International has commissioned its third solar cell manufacturing facility at Baddi in Himachal Pradesh, significantly expanding its production capabilities. The new plant adds around 1 GW of capacity, taking the company’s total solar cell manufacturing capacity to nearly 2 GW. In Short ; NTPC Green Energy has added 14.43 MW of solar capacity to its Khavda-I Solar Project in Gujarat, further strengthening its renewable energy portfolio. The new commissioning reflects steady progress in India’s utility-scale solar deployment and supports national goals of expanding clean energy generation while enhancing grid sustainability and energy security. In Short : Mumbai has achieved a major milestone in its energy transition with the completion of the Kudus–Aarey HVDC project, enabling the city to receive 1000 MW of renewable power.
